数据库系统是由多个部分组成的,这些部分与每个数据库系统都有关联性。 在此文中,我们将详细解释每个部分并探讨每个部分在数据库系统中的作用。
1. 数据库管理系统(DBMS)
数据库管理系统是数据库系统的核心,可以说是整个数据库系统的控制器。 它控制着数据如何存储、访问、管理、备份等。数据库管理系统可以通过其特定的编程语言来操作数据,例如SQL和NoSQL。 常见的DBMS包括:Oracle, MySQL, PostgreSQL, MongoDB等。
2. 数据库
数据库是数据库系统的另外一个重要组成部分,它是数据存储和管理的地方。 数据库可以理解为一个容器,可以存储多种数据类型,例如文本、数字、图像、音频等。不同的数据库系统有不同的类型,例如关系性数据库和非关系性数据库。
3. 数据库模式
数据库模式描述了数据库中数据的结构,表示了实体和它们之间的关系。 它包含了多个表格和字段,以及在每个表格中的数据类型。 在数据库系统中,有几种常见的数据库模式,例如关系性模式,对象模式和半结构化模式。
4. 数据库管理员
数据库管理员用于设计、安装、配置、监控和升级数据库系统。 它是数据库系统中非常重要的角色。 数据库管理员需要维护数据的安全性、完整性和一致性,以及确保数据库系统的高可用性。
5. 应用程序
应用程序是用户操作数据库的接口。 它通过数据库管理系统来访问数据库,允许用户浏览和快速检索所需数据。 应用程序可以是Web应用程序、移动应用程序或桌面应用程序,它们通常可以通过一些编程语言和框架来制作和操作。
综上所述,数据库系统既包括了软件组件,也包括了硬件组件,如磁盘存储和存储管理器等。 在很大程度上,数据库系统组件的选择以及影响它们的因素取决于数据库的需求,例如数据大小、可用性、维护成本和预算等。
扫码咨询 领取资料